In summary, ceiling grids are an essential feature in modern interior design and construction. They offer a combination of practical benefits, including aesthetic flexibility, acoustic control, and easy maintenance. As spaces become more dynamic and multifaceted, the role of ceiling grids will surely continue to evolve, making them a staple in design for years to come. Understanding their structure and benefits not only aids designers and builders but also informs property owners on the best options for their specific needs. Whether constructing anew or renovating an existing space, the ceiling grid undoubtedly amplifies utility and style.
